Pakistan’s first electric bus service inaugurates in Karachi Today

According to Sindh Information Minister Sharjeel Memon, Karachi would serve as the first stop for Pakistan’s first electric bus service.

According to an announcement made by Sharjeel Memon, the Sindh government’s transportation division will launch Pakistan’s first electric bus service tomorrow for residents of Karachi.

Tomorrow marks the launch of the first electric bus route, which runs from Clifton Clock to Seaview Beach. He claimed that Karachi will soon see the introduction of the first batch of 50 electric, environmentally friendly cars.

Additionally, a solar power system was set up to power the buses. After a single charge, each bus will travel 240 kilometers, he noted.

On Monday, the information minister gave the appropriate agencies instructions to launch the People’s Electric Bus Service right away and to finalise its first route through Karachi.

He had stated that the government had opted to expedite the procurement procedure and had approved the purchase of more buses. He continued by saying that new bus routes are something that the people of Karachi want.

Memon had stated in November of last year that the Sindh government’s transportation division would begin a new bus service in Karachi.
